Praia da Ursa is a wild beach located near Cabo da Roca in the Natural Park of Sintra-Cascais. A beautiful beach but hard to reach with bad access. There is a pair of huge rocks that emerge from the water, in the north side and right next to it, a huge rock that seems the […]

The origin of Sintra is lost over time through traces dating from 12 000a.C. It is known however that in the Pre Historic time Sintra was Called “Mons Lunae” (Moon Hill) tradition of astral cults, still visible today in many monuments. Located on the ouskirts of Sintra, a Bar housed in a former mill. This friendly bar has a pleasant terrace with panoramic views of sea and mountains. The atmosphere is cozy and the decor denotes Mexican influences. Open daily from 12.00pm until 02.00am Telefone: 219292523 Rua Campo da Bola, Vivenda I, Moinho 2705-001 Azóia

Situated in the historic center of Sintra, classified World Heritage by UNESCO, Quinta da Regaleira is a place with a mind of its own.
